Hurtigruten is one of Norway's strongest brands and is a spearhead in Norwegian and international tourism. Its ships have been operating in and exploring some of the most challenging waters in the world since 1893; the roots go back to the Norwegian polar heroes.

The combination of local transport and tourism with its ships in a year-round route along the Norwegian coast creates today's authentic experiences for guests from all over the world.

Hurtigruten is the world leader in exploration travel which comes with a responsibility to ensure that sustainability is integrated across all of the operations. It focuses on innovation, technology and concrete measures to explore as responsibly as possible. The Expedition ships offer unforgettable voyages to Antarctica, Greenland, Iceland, Spitsbergen, the Americas, Europe and across the Atlantic Ocean etc.

Formed in 1893, Hurtigruten Group is the world’s leading adventure travel group. We have 2,400+ employees worldwide, representing more than 50 nationalities. They form part of three main business areas — Hurtigruten Expeditions, Norwegian Coastal Express and Hurtigruten Svalbard — which offer unique small-ship and land-based adventures from pole-to-pole. For almost 130 years we have pushed boundaries on expedition travel and sailed tourists, locals and cargo around the Norwegian coastline and polar regions. We have made Norway more connected, impacting the lives of millions of people. And we continue to share knowledge with our international guests about wildlife, local communities, science and the natural world.
